Firmware Engineer Co-Op
NewBe an early applicantIn This Role, Your Responsibilities Will Be:
Firmware Development Tools & Infrastructure (70%)
- Develop and enhance firmware build automation and toolchains
- Create CI workflows and automated testing solutions
- Integrate code quality, security, and static analysis tools
- Improve source control, code review, and release processes
- Document and standardize development workflows
Embedded Firmware Implementation (30%)
- Develop firmware for next-generation actuator platforms
- Assist with BSP, driver, and application software development
- Debug firmware and support hardware bring-up activities
- Participate in product validation and testing
- Collaborate with cross-functional engineering teams
